    Hi guys !
    I have a problem with the form I made this morning.
    The form works when the page is in draft mode, once I publish the page, it doesn’t work anymore.
    The icon of sending keeps turning on and on and on.
    Even if I don’t completed the required field, it doesn’t display anything.

    I already tried to :
    -Desactivate the theme and activate another one
    -Delete CF7 and install it again
    -Turn off all the plugins (except cf7)
    -Try it on IE, Firefox, Google Chrome and Opera
    -Try it on windows 8.1, windows 7 and Linux

    I tried with another plugins and it’s doing the same thing, the form is not working.

  • RE: The icon of sending keeps turning on and on and on.
    Even if I don’t completed the required field, it doesn’t display anything.

    This is most likely due to a JavaScript conflict with either your current WordPress theme or one of the other plugins you are using – see Contact Form 7 Email Issues – there is a link there that covers JavaScript Conflicts.

    Step by step approach to finding JavaScript Conflicts

    1. Switch temporarily to a WordPress default theme (Twenty Eleven etc.) and see if the problem goes away.

    If it does, you’ve most likely got a JavaScript conflict with your current WordPress theme.

    If switching to default theme doesn’t help it could be one of the plugins you are using that is causing the problem.

    2. Disable all plugins other than Contact Form 7

    If doing that solves the problem, you can then add back each item – one by one, until you find the real cause of the problem.

    You will need to disable, temporarily, ALL JavaScript, other than that from CF7, including anything in your theme (switch temporarily to a default theme), if you want to get to the source of the problem.
